Absorption Type Vapor Recovery Unit

* Summary

Vapor Recovery Unit is to collect the organic vapor discharged during the manufacturing, storage, loading and unloading processes of various industries and recycle it by means of condensation, adsorption, absorption, membrane separation, etc. so as to finally satisfy the emission standards and create certain economic benefits for the end user.

The Absorption Process is suitable for treatment of low & medium concentration oil vapor. As long as proper absorbent is available at site, absorption process is recommended owing to the easy operation and reduced investment.

Though usually applied in combination with other process, the absorption process can also be solely applied for treatment of substances easily soluble in water, acidic or alkaline liquid. For instance, it can use water to handle waste gas containing methanol, acetic acid, ammonia, acetone, etc. to make it acceptable for the emission standard.

Principle / Flow Procedure

Taking advantage of different solubility of different compositions, The Absorption Process can separate those easily soluble compositions from others. Most light hydrocarbons dissolve into the absorbent and waste gas containing little light hydrocarbons is discharged from the top of the tower. For different types of oil vapor, the absorbents can be water, acidic aqueous solution, alkaline aqueous solution, gasoline, diesel and heavy hydrocarbon, etc. More explanation about the process will be given taking methanol recovery with water absorption technology for example.

The oil vapor after flame arrester is pressurized by an induced fan and then delivered into the absorption tower, where it contacts the absorbent liquid (water) flowing in opposite direction for vapor-liquid equilibrium. Acceptable emission is obtained after multi-stage equilibrium and discharged from the top, while the liquid with rich methanol leaves from the bottom.

* Structure & Parameter (typical project)

Application Vapor recovery
Equipment name Vapor Recovery Unit
Model QY/VR series
Capacity 50-5000 m3/h
Structure Skid-mounted
Material Carbon steel
Fabrication code GB150.1~4-2011
Design code

GB50759-2012

Q/SH0117-2007

Design pressure Micro positive pressure
Design temperature Ambient
Applicable exhaust gas Low & medium concentration oil vapor
Type of absorption tower Atmospheric pressure filling tower
Type filling High efficient filling in order
Control method PLC automatic control
Main measuring point Pressure signal, level signal, flow signal
Main chain alarm system Pressure signal for interlocked blower start-up/shut down; Level signal for interlocked drain pump start-up/shut down; Flow signal to control opening of absorbent liquid valve
Connection Bolted
Seal Flange
